Sandra L. Smith, 90, of Roaring Spring, went home to be with the Lord on Wednesday at UPMC Mercy Hospital in Pittsburgh. She was born in Woodvale, Pa., the daughter of the late Ralphard and Leila (Dixon) Black.

She was twice married: first to Glen Worthing and then to Donald I. Smith, both of whom preceded her in death.

She is survived by three children: Kevin Smith and wife, Kelly, of New Enterprise; Elaine Snively and husband, Bill, of Martinsburg; and Julie Maher and husband, Cory, of Roaring Spring; five grandchildren: Deanna Replogle, Brock Snively, Kadden Smith, Kyler Smith and Jake Maher; four great-grandchildren; a sister, Marlene Putt of Everett; a brother, Allen Black and wife, Sandy, of Celina, Tenn.; a nephew, Trampas Hobble and wife, Michele, and their children: Hunter, Trapper and Fisher of Three Springs; and a special friend and sidekick, Ken Klotz of Roaring Spring, whom she had many memories with.

She was preceded in death by a brother, Ralphard Black; and a sister, Linda Hobble.

Sandra was a member of Woodbury Church of the Brethren.

She graduated from Saxton-Liberty High School in 1953 and retired from Cove Surgical with more than 50 years of service.

Sandra loved racing and was a loyal season ticket holder to both Port Royal and Williams Grove Speedways. She had a passion for traveling and taking cruises all over the world.

Sandra was a very loving and generous person with her family and church family. She had been a member of the Order of the Eastern Star.
